Daughter of a law professor at Northwestern University, she moved with her family to Los Angeles when he transferred to the University of California at Los Angeles (U.C.L.A.). She began acting in school plays at North Hollywood High, graduated from The Oakwood School and then continued her stage training at the American Conservatory Theatre in San Francisco and the drama division of The Juilliard School in New York. Following a pleasant screen debut in Robert Redford's Oscar-winning Ordinary People (1980), McGovern gave a great performance as Evelyn Nesbit in Ragtime (1981) for which she earned an Academy Award nomination as Best Supporting Actress. She has continued performing on stage between film assignments rather than concentrate on being a film star.

Tivia:
Sings and plays guitar in her own band Sadie & The Hot Heads. Owns an electric Rickenbacker guitar.Was engaged to Sean Penn after falling in love on the set of Racing with the Moon (1984).Has lived in West London (UK) since 1992.Her band Sadie & The Hot Heads (formed 2007) opened for Sting at the Montreux Jazz Festival Switzerland (July 16th, 2013).As a young actress on the New York stage, McGovern was required in one play to pray over some candles that were set on a bed. Realizing that the bed had caught fire halfway through her monologue, McGovern kept talking while trying to pat out the flames. She thought she had the situation pretty well under control, when firefighters suddenly arrived onstage to clear the theater.Dropped out of college when she was studying acting at The Juilliard School in order to accept the ing��nue role in Ordinary People (1980).Has two daughters named Matilda Curtis (b. July 1993) and Grace Curtis (b. 1998).Now lives in England, UK (April 2006)Her paternal grandfather, William Montgomery McGovern, was a prominent adventurer. Her maternal great-grandfathers were Ethelbert Watts, a U.S. diplomat, and Charles P. Snyder, an Admiral, and her maternal great-great-grandfather was Congressman Charles P. Snyder.Has a brother, William Montgomery McGovern, "Monty" who is a professor of mathematics.Appeared opposite Richard Dreyfuss and David Suchet in the disastrous production of Complicit directed by Kevin Spacey at the Old Vic. (January 2009)Met husband-to-be Simon Curtis on Tales from Hollywood (1992), an episode of the popular BBC TV series Performance (1991), where Curtis was a producer.Her younger sister Cammie McGovern is a novelist, whose latest novel [2006] is "Eye Contact."Counts Henry James and Edith Wharton among her favorite authors.Recently appeared on British television in a situation comedy written by her husband Simon Curtis. (February 2008)Can be seen in The Making of 'Amadeus' (2002), uncredited. In footage from her screen tests (in costume, apparently testing for the role of Constanze) her face has been blurred but her name can be read clearly on handwritten lists of actors that appear onscreen in a shooting log.Is appearing in the British series "Downton Abbey" which is presently showing on PBS in the USA. (January 2011)She has Scottish, English, and more distant German, ancestry.Daughter of Katie and Bill McGovern.The Film Production section of Variety, Aug 4, 1982, shows the film "Beginners" started filming July 6, 1982, in New York under direction of Michael Gottlieb, for Embassy Pictures, starring Elizabeth McGovern, Jane Alexander, Robert Carradine, filming suspended July 23, 1982. No evidence the film was ever completed.The San Ysidro (San Diego, California) McDonald's massacre occurred on her 23rd birthday. |
